Former Everton striker Brian McBride is delighted for Leon Osman over his England recognition.
The American, now 41 years of age, actually made his Everton debut on the day that Osman made his own against Tottenham Hotspur in January 2003.
"You could see the talent that he had back then and he has just continued to grow," said McBride to evertonfc.com.
"He is a player who is so special with his feet. He has the ability to get out of tight spaces and also to bring his teammates into play. You can see why he's lasted so long and he keeps going."
